Colocar Resposta 
 
Avaliação do Tópico:
  • 0 votos - 0 Média
  • 1
  • 2
  • 3
  • 4
  • 5
Duvidas no codigo de funçoes
28-11-2010, 14:21
Mensagem: #9
RE: Duvidas no codigo de funçoes
Na função date() tens o mesmo problema que te referi à pouco: não se indica o tamanho do array na declaração da função, passa-se como parametro extra. Por acaso está a funcionar pq depois no código usas o #define que define o tamanho do array (SIZE).

Além disso, a comparação de datas na função date() também não está correcta. Por um lado,

day <= gestao[l].data.dia || day >= gestao[l].data.dia

é o mesmo que

day == gestao[l].data.dia

Por outro, estás a comparar mal o mês. Aceitas datas com o mês indicado e também os meses anteriores (Se o utilizador pedir info para a data 2010-11-28, o programa tb mostra 2010-10-28, 2010-09-28, etc, etc, etc.) Wink

Quanto à função de que se falou no outro post, lamento informar-te mas conseguiste organizar exactamente a mesma comparação de outra forma. A forma actual e a anterior são equivalentes e dão o mesmo resultado.

Pedidos de ajuda via PM serão ignorados
Acordo ortográfico? Desconheço, obrigado Wink
Agradeço ao Chrome o facto de os meus posts nao terem acentos Evil
Procurar todas as mensagens deste utilizador
Citar esta mensagem numa resposta
Colocar Resposta 


Mensagem neste Tópico
RE: Duvidas no codigo de funçoes - Corvus - 28-11-2010 14:21

Saltar Fórum:


Utilizadores a ver este tópico: 4 Visitante(s)